Max has gotten stoppages, but it is because he hits you with dozens of shots and hurts you with accumulative damage. He could not match Volk's power and therefore couldn't get past his shots without eating a big one himself. Along with the leg kicks, this prevented him throwing volume without taking damage. Volk knew Max couldn't couldn't take him shot for shot, and forced him into a fight that he was highly unlikely to lose.

The key to beating these tall featherweights like Zabit, Max, Kattar, Woodsen, etc is taking away their legs, which slows down their movement, takes away their kicks and neutralizes the reach disadvantage. They often can't hit as hard shot for shot as the shorter and more muscular guys so this forces them to fight against their own natural advantages.
